Sony introduces two new native 4K home cinema projectors

Today Sony announced the launch of two new native 4K home cinema projectors (4096 x 2160) featuring the powerful "X1 for projector" image processor, based on technologies used in Sony's BRAVIA TVs and optimized for projectors. The processor includes innovative technologies for high-precision frame analysis that enable features such as Dynamic HDR Enhancer and Reality Creation.

The 2200lm VPL-VW890ES laser model with premium ARC-F (All- Range Crisp Focus) and the 1500lm VPL-VW290ES lamp model, deliver an immersive viewing experience that faithfully conveys the vision of content creators, with more realistic details and textures and optimal contrast. Both Sony 4K projectors feature unique Super Resolution Reality Creation technology and a native 4K panel that deliver high-quality, detailed images.

The new VPL-VW890ES and VPL-VW290ES will replace the previous models respectively, namely: the VPL-VW870ES and the VPL-VW270ES. Like their predecessors, the new models also include the reduced input lag mode, which greatly improves the display's reaction speed to ensure gamers have the best possible experience, along with the incredibly detailed image quality they expect from a product of high quality. As for the availability of both new projectors, finally, both the VPL-VW890ES and the VPL-VW290ES can be ordered starting today.
